Building B is the second to be built of three eleven-storey office blocks that will eventually comprise the Podium Park development in Kraków. Globalworth’s latest purchase adds 18,800 sqm of modern office space to the market and also has 265 parking spaces. The purchase of Podium Park by Globalworth took place in December 2019 in a transaction worth a total of around EUR 134 mln. The first stage of the development project was handed over for use in 2018. Eventually, the entire complex is to include 55,000 sqm of leasable space. 

 

The project has raised a lot of interest among potential tenants, particularly among IT and fintech companies, and this has resulted in it being commercialised to a high level. 

 

In line with Globalworth’s motto of “A place to grow”, TechnipFMC, which has hitherto been a tenant of Quattro Business Park – another Kraków building in the Globalworth portfolio, has decided to increase its office area and relocate to Podium B. Taken together with Ailleron, the second tenant in the building, a total of 80% of the space has been occupied with both companies having already begun their operations from the building. UK-based Revolut, a leading company in the fintech industry will also have its offices (over 5,300 sqm) in Podium Park.

Podium Park is one of the greenest office developments in Poland. It is one of the few developments in the country to have the highest possible BREEAM rating of ‘Outstanding’ and the first building of the complex also received the highest ever assessment in the country, having been awarded a score of 96.2% during its certification.

 

Podium Park stands out with its excellent location at the junction of al. Jana Pawła II and ul. Izydora Stella-Sawickiego, in a rapidly developing district in the city next to the Cracow University of Technology and near several bus and tram stops.

 

An important part of the development is the 4,000 sqm green space filled with plants where you can relax in the fresh air. Office workers and their guests will also be able to make use of the cycling facilities and car park with 800 spaces. The building’s external facade ensures the highest thermal comfort and was designed to the standards and norms that came into force in 2021.
